The paint on my Type R is quite frankly laughable in it's application... funny as was speaking with a body shop and was asking and they said the paint on Honda's for a few years has been poor. Time will tell the quality of this Mazda... however my old Mazda Xedos 6 was exceptional, I did 197k miles in that thing and not a spec anywhere... same with my 53 plate Saab Aero... nothing BUT the plastic door mirrors are terrible on Saabs all corroding after a few years. Seems we got superb quality and now it's like we're going backwards a little now... I looked under the body of my RX8 the other day and it's a rust fest everything corroded. Not a patch on the Saab or the Honda... then again might all just be surface rust but to me, it's not a good sign.

It's not just bodywork, the amount of corroded alloys... Mazda seem to be the worst with the worst corrosion in history. The guy who did my RX8's love Mazdas, he says they make up 20% of his repairs lol.

Renault and Peugeot seem immune to rust, shame about everything else
Friggin hell, I'll be double checking that lol, cheers man. As for Pugs yeah, galvanised panels help... you could always tell an accident Pug years ago, the front wings would rust, and you knew they were aftermarket replacements lol
